#0dadbf h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0dadbf is composed of 5.1% red, 67.8%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.2%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 186.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 40%. #0dadbf color hex could be obtained by blending #1affff with #005b7f.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

● #0dadbf color description : Strong cyan.
The hexadecimal color #0dadbf has RGB values of R:13, G:173,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 896447.
